Transaction 3d66c142feaaa1e66bf20a55d998b88d510681dabfae84cb58f846b8a19fb6fd
1 Input
1 Output
-
3d66c142feaaa1e66bf20a55d998b88d510681dabfae84cb58f846b8a19fb6fd:0
- value
- 47500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 961c434b694381d3450eae48d0d468071ac1aa49 OP_EQUAL
- address
- 3FNj94FhoQBbhVyx2XNNzpomSDzf2SUYt3